Abstract
PURPOSE:To obtain a high-efficiency speaker with improved resistance to input, by continuously cooling heat produced by a voice coil by a filling fluid. CONSTITUTION:Two internal and external spaces 17a and 17b formed of yoke members 11, and 14-16 of a magnetic material, center pole 1, voice coil bobbin 5, and plate 3 are filled with cooling fluid 18. Here, movable bobbin 5 is sealed by magnetic liquid 13 obtained by dispersing iron into oil which never mixes with fluid 18 in spaces of members 14 and 16 and bobbin 5, and voice coil 4 is positioned in space 17b without meeting members 15 and 16. As a result, coil 4 is driven in fluid 18 in spaces 17a and 17b; and a large input of heat is cooled by fluid 18 and cooling effect is maintained by the convection of the fluid. Consequently, a high-e-ficiency speaker with high resistance to input can be obtained.
